Accommodations

Our primary residence will be Erata Hotel, a 3-star hotel, located in East Legon, a suburb of Accra. In Cape Coast we reside at Park Springs Hotel and in the Volta we stay at Liate Wote's Guest House, for an ensuite village experience.

Transportation

Travel effortlessly between destinations in a climate-controlled luxury coach, ensuring comfort and convenience as you explore every corner of Ghana in style.

Trip Itinerary

Daily Activities

Day One - Tues, July 7th - Accra Tour

Airport pickup | Welcome & Orientation | Independence Square | Dr. Kwame Nkrumah Mausoleum | Lunch @ Check into Erata Hotel (Accra)

Day Two - Wed, July 8th - Aburi Mountains Tour

Aburi Botanical Gardens | Quad Biking | Carver’s Market (Aburi)

Day Three - Thurs, July 9th - Cape Coast Tour

Asafo Art Gallery | Kakum National Park (Cape Coast)

Day Four - Fri, July 10th - Cape Coast Tour

Slave Dungeon | Naming Ceremony (Cape Coast)

Day Five - Sat, July 11th- Crown Forest Resort

Horse Back Riding | Game Drive (Kasoa)

Day Six - Sun, July 12th - Rest Day

Residing at Erata Hotel in East Legon (Accra)

Day Seven - Mon, July 13th - Volta Region Tour

Wli Waterfalls (Volta Region)

Day Eight - Tues, July 14th - Votla Region

Climb Mt. Afadjato | (Accra)

Day Nine - Wed, July 15th - Last minute Shopping

Arts center & Oxford St. (Accra)

Day Ten - Thurs, July 16th- Early Departure

Kotoka Airport (Accra)
